It is common for state governments to allot tax-free screenings of films in theatres across the state. The AP government previously did this for Balakrishna’s Gautami Putra Sathakarni. This is usually done for films with historic prominence.
Now, there’s a talk that Prabhas’s Adipurush, a mythological action epic based on Ramayan should get a country-wide tax free implementation.
With tax-free policy, the ticket prices will come down greatly which will in turn encourage more audiences to watch the film and thus generate more revenue.
Being a film based on the Hindu mythological epic of Ramayan, will Adipurush get the tax-free benefit? We have to wait and see.
